SACRAMENTO, Calif. (AP) - A Sacramento divorce attorney accused
of fondling five female clients is going to prison.
Fifty-eight-year-old Gary Appelblatt was sentenced to 18 months in prison Tuesday after pleading no contest to four counts of sexual battery and one count of attempted sexual battery. The judge also ordered him to register as a sex offender.
Authorities say Appelblatt molested the women during divorce consultations by pretending he was a pharmacist and wanting to examine their health. He allegedly used a stethoscope to check their breathing and performed or tried to perform breast exams.
Several of Appelblatt's alleged victims told the court he took advantage of their vulnerability.
Appelblatt apologized before his sentencing and said he has "mental issues."
